Further edits

I have recently re-created our magazine cover and put further edits in place to ensure that it is of an exceptionally high standard. The Empire logo, is exactly the same as it would be on anyother magazine cover. We have also placed the date and price in the above v of the M, just like how they do on the actually magazine itself. Thus making it as professional as possible. I have placed a tag line above the logo - THE ULTIMATE MOVIE & DVD REVIEW GUIDE - this is a significant part of the magazine as it is on more or less every single magazine cover but also that it tells the audience what the magazine is about, you wouldn't have the image we have say on the cover of a disney princess magazine it just wouldn't work. Another change was that i took out the exclusive with redwood stars, as it looked rubbish when the film was mentioned twice, it is clear enough as it is that they are mentioned throughout the magazine. Another minor change was the tag line underneither the Redwood logo - i changed it from
'do you believe in children's stories' to Do you believe everything you hear?
this seems to react better with the audience than do you believe in children's stories, as they'd think it's just another 'Blair Witch Project' film. Which in these days is getting repeated way to much.
